The moment a metal cap settles onto its groove begins with an unmistakably sharp click, reverberating softly through a confined space before the action subsides into a fine, almost imperceptible threadâonâsteel rasp. That initial burst carries just enough bite to punctuate the sceneâclean, bright, yet not overpoweringâwhile the subsequent grinding introduces an understated tension, hinting at the weight of a sealed cylinder beneath the surface. Together they mimic the intimate feel of someone working in an engine bay, where every small motion has audible consequence.
In terms of sonic texture, the click is a brief, highâfrequency sparkle, whereas the steel rub provides a lowâtoâmid-range hiss that drifts toward ambient warmth. The resulting blend creates a layered soundscape reminiscent of a quiet workshop: the farâaway chatter of tools fades into an almost tangible backdrop, suggesting a tight, real-world environment rather than a fabricated studio artifact. Spatial cues are deliberately modest; the fader remains close in the stereo field so the listener perceives it as coming straight from the foreground, reinforcing that handsâon interaction feeling.
From a production standpoint, the clip is engineered to sit comfortably at the edge of a mixâideal for adding realism to dialogue bubbles or onâscreen instructions. The metallic click can be dialed up for dramatic emphasis during a cinematic cut, while the soft grind supports subtler moments such as a tutorial pause or a characterâs mindful inspection. Layering it with a faint, cool engine hum or a muted door slam further deepens the realism without cluttering the main elements. This modular approach means the sample can fit seamlessly into both linear storytelling and interactive media.
